Flights to Namibia: Overview
Planning a trip to Namibia can be an exhilarating experience, and one of the first steps is to book your flights. Namibia is a vast country, and the best way to get there is by flying into Hosea Kutako International Airport (WDH) in Windhoek, the capital city. This airport serves as the primary gateway for international travelers, making it the ideal starting point for your Namibian adventure.
Several airlines operate flights to Namibia, including British Airways, South African Airways, and Ethiopian Airlines. These carriers offer a range of options, from economy to business class, ensuring that you can find a flight that suits your budget and comfort preferences.
When booking your flights, it’s essential to consider the time of year and how it may affect your travel plans. The peak tourist season in Namibia is from June to October, and flights may be more expensive during this time. If you’re looking for cheap flights, consider traveling during the off-season, which is from November to May. This period not only offers more affordable flights but also fewer crowds, allowing you to enjoy Namibia’s stunning landscapes in peace.
It’s also important to note that there are no direct flights from the US, Canada, Australia, or New Zealand to Namibia. Most flights have a layover in Johannesburg or Cape Town, South Africa. However, some airlines offer connecting flights with shorter layovers, so it’s worth shopping around to find the best option for your needs. Frankfurt to Windhoek: A Comfortable Direct Flight
The majority of European travelers to Namibia fly via Frankfurt. This vibrant German city offers the only direct flight from Europe to Windhoek, Namibia’s capital, operated by Eurowings Discover and Lufthansa. These airlines provide regular flights, taking you from the heart of Europe to the heart of Namibia in just about 10 hours. And while you might be in the air for a while, rest assured, the flight is designed to be as comfortable as possible, with spacious seating and entertainment options.
But why is Windhoek the gateway? Simple. From Windhoek, you can easily access some of the country’s top attractions, including the Namib Desert, the Etosha National Park, and the Skeleton Coast. So, sit back, relax, and prepare yourself for the adventure of a lifetime.

Connecting Flights via Major Hubs
While direct flights are fantastic, you may find that a connecting flight is your best option depending on where you’re coming from in Europe. If you’re flying from cities like Paris or London, you’ll most likely connect through Johannesburg or Cape Town in South Africa.
Through Johannesburg and Cape Town: The Easy Hops
Let’s be honest: connecting flights can sometimes feel like a hassle. The cabin crew plays a crucial role in ensuring a comfortable and pleasant experience during these connecting flights. But connecting through major hubs like Johannesburg or Cape Town actually makes your journey to Namibia a whole lot easier. From these two vibrant South African cities, you can catch a quick flight to Windhoek or Walvis Bay (a popular coastal town). The flight time is short—just about 2 hours—so you won’t be wasting too much time in the air.
European Hubs to South Africa: Your Shortcut to Namibia
Now, you may be asking yourself, “How do I get to Johannesburg or Cape Town in the first place?” Don’t worry; we’ve got you covered! From major European cities like London, Paris, and Frankfurt, you’ll find daily flights to South Africa with airlines like British Airways, Air France, and Lufthansa. Once you arrive in Johannesburg or Cape Town, you’re just a short flight away from your Namibian adventure.

Flights from Around the World
Flights from the US, Canada, Australia, and New Zealand to Namibia
If you’re traveling from the US, Canada, Australia, or New Zealand, you’ll need to book a flight with a layover in Johannesburg or Cape Town, South Africa. These major hubs offer numerous connecting flights to Namibia, making your journey as seamless as possible.
-
From the US: You can fly from New York (JFK) or Los Angeles (LAX) to Johannesburg (JNB) with South African Airways, and then connect to Windhoek (WDH) with a short layover. This route is popular for its convenience and relatively short layover times.
-
From Canada: You can fly from Toronto (YYZ) or Vancouver (YVR) to Johannesburg (JNB) with Air Canada, and then connect to Windhoek (WDH) with a short layover. This option provides a smooth transition from North America to Southern Africa.
-
From Australia: You can fly from Sydney (SYD) or Melbourne (MEL) to Johannesburg (JNB) with Qantas, and then connect to Windhoek (WDH) with a short layover. This route is favored for its efficiency and the quality of service provided by Qantas.
-
From New Zealand: You can fly from Auckland (AKL) to Johannesburg (JNB) with Air New Zealand, and then connect to Windhoek (WDH) with a short layover. This option offers a comfortable and straightforward journey from the Pacific to Africa.
It’s worth noting that some airlines offer cheaper flights with longer layovers, so it’s essential to compare prices and flight durations to find the best option for your needs. Visa Requirements: Don’t Let Paperwork Stand in Your Way
Now, before you get too excited, there’s something important to take care of: the visa. If you’re a European citizen, chances are you’ll need to obtain a visa to enter Namibia. As of April 2025, the visa fee for citizens of 33 countries, including Spain, will be €84. It’s a small price to pay for an extraordinary experience, but make sure you’ve sorted it out before your departure.
Health and Safety: Better Safe Than Sorry
Traveling to Namibia doesn’t require a long list of vaccinations, but it’s always a good idea to check with your doctor before you go. Malaria is present in certain parts of Namibia, especially in the north, so be sure to take the necessary precautions. Also, don’t forget your travel insurance—it’s always better to be safe than sorry.

Popular Destinations in Namibia
Namibia is a vast and beautiful country, with many popular destinations to explore. Each location offers its own unique charm and attractions, making it a must-visit destination for any traveler.
-
Windhoek: The capital city of Namibia, Windhoek, is a great place to start your journey. Visit the Christ Church, the National Museum, and the Namibia Craft Centre. The city’s blend of modernity and tradition provides a fascinating introduction to the country.
-
Etosha National Park: One of Africa’s premier game reserves, Etosha is home to a wide variety of wildlife, including elephants, lions, and giraffes. The park’s vast salt pan and waterholes offer excellent opportunities for game viewing and photography.
-
Swakopmund: A charming coastal town, Swakopmund is known for its beautiful beaches, outdoor activities, and German colonial architecture. Whether you’re interested in sandboarding, quad biking, or simply relaxing by the sea, Swakopmund has something for everyone.
-
Walvis Bay: A pop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ts, Walvis Bay is known for its beautiful lagoon, birdwatching, and water sports. The town’s vibrant marine life and stunning landscapes make it a haven for nature lovers.
-
Victoria Falls: Located on the border with Zambia, Victoria Falls is one of the world’s most spectacular waterfalls. While not in Namibia, it’s a popular extension for travelers exploring Southern Africa. The sheer power and beauty of the falls are a sight to behold.
